Study Summary

The purpose of this study is to determine the efficacy and safety of a peri-articular multimodal injection for post-operative pain control following operative management of closed, rotational ankle fractures. Enrolled subjects will be randomized to either receive or not receive intra-operative injections in addition to standard opioid analgesic regimens. Patients will be treated with standard of care surgical techniques by the treating orthopaedic surgeon for the patient's specific fracture pattern. The patients randomized into the injection cohort will receive a 25cc intra-operative injection with 200 mg ropivacaine, 0.6 mg epinephrine, 5 mg and morphine into the local superficial and deep peri-incisional tissues while under general anesthesia. Total post-operative opioid consumption expressed in morphine equivalent dose will be recorded, including IV and oral opioids. Time in hours from operation conclusion to discharge and discharge disposition (to where the patient is discharged) will also be recorded. Post-operative pain scores will be assessed and recorded in the immediate post-operative period and every 4 hours subsequently until the patient is discharged. Medication related side effects will be monitored. The investigators hypothesize that the injection cohort will have reduced pain scores, lower narcotic requirements, shorter length of stay, and be more likely to discharge to home following surgery.

Interventions

  • DRUG Epinephrine
  • DRUG Ropivacaine
  • DRUG Morphine
  • DRUG 0.9% sodium chloride solution
